Accessories belts tension
Belts tensioning values are:
- alternator belt 253 – 273 Hz
- compressor belt 150 – 155 Hz
- power steering pumps belt 151 – 161 Hz
- compressor belt / DA pump 222 ± 8 Hz
A ccessories belt tensioning method.
Belt tensioning is to be performed with cold engine.
Mount the new belt.
Tighten the belt till obtaining the prescribed mounting tensioning.
Block the tensioner.
Perform three engine crankshaft rotations. P lace t he reading head of the MOT 1505 device i n the m easurement area and check if the
belt tensioning is within the mounting prescribed values; restore is necessary.
REMARK :
Once a belt is dismounted, is not to be remounted, but replaced.

DISTRIBUTION SYSTEMDistribution belt
Set the engine at setting poi nt (see method described in chapter 10 “ Engine assembly”,
page 10 –19). Loosen the tensioning roller nut.
Dismount the distribution belt.
REMOU NT I NG
Mount a new distribution belt.
Tension the distribution belt to a value of 145 – 185 Hz by means of the MOT 1505 device
(see the method described in c hapter 10 “ Engine assembly”, page 10 –33 ).
Perform the dismounting operations in the reverse order.
Tighten to the required moment the screws.
Remount the pulley for accessories belt (for vehicles equipped with air conditioning and/or
power steering). Obligatory tighten the screw of the crankshaft pulley hub to the required moment of 2 daNm
plus an angle of 68° ± 6 °
Mount and tension the alternator belt and the accessories belt, observing the method for belts
tensioning described in chapter 07 “ Accessories belts tensioning “.
The belts te nsioning values are:
Alternator belt 253 – 273 Hz
Co mpressor belt 150 – 155 Hz
Power steering pump belt 151 – 161 Hz
Co mpressor / power steering pump belt 214 – 230 Hz

ALTERNATOR – STARTER
B. The indicator is lighting, engine being running.
This shows a charging failure, which may be caused by:
- alternator driving belt broken, charging wire connected to alternator is broken (+ per-
manent);
-alternator failure(rotor, stator, diodes or brushes);
- voltage regulator failure;
- an over voltage.
C. Client is claiming a charging defect, but the luminous indicator is correctly oper-
ating.
If the adjusted voltage is smaller than 13.5 V, check the alternator.
The defect may be caused by : -worn diode;
-b roken phase;
- collector wear or coal dust.
VOLTAGE CHECKING
Connect a voltmeter to the battery plugs and read its voltage value.
Start the engine and speed the e ngine till the voltmeter needle i s set on the adjusted voltage.
This voltage must be between 13.5 V and 14.8 V
Connect maximum of consumers; the voltage must still between 13.5 V and 14.8 V.
AT T E N T I O N !
In case electric arch welding is performed on vehicle obligatory disconnect the bat-
tery and the voltage controller (alternator).

DIAGNOSTIC
Special tool: CLIP tester and accessories for physical measurements.
CH ARGING CIRCUIT CHECKING
CLIP tester i s enabling the a lternator checking, by m easuring t he genera ted vol tage and
intensity with and without electric consumers.
REMARK: The ammeter pliers is of inductive type 0 ÷ 1000 A. Its mounting is done
without the battery disconnecting, enabling so the memorized data preserving and the
adapting values from the injection c omputer.
Mount the ammeter di rectly on t he alternator e xit, having t he arrow directed towards the
alternator.
The measurements are to be performed in three stages :
- measurement of the battery voltage with contact taken off;
- measurement without consumers of the adjusted voltage and generated intensity;
- measurement, with maximum of consumers, of the adjusted voltage and generated in-
tensity.
The values resulting further to the measurements, lead to following interpretations:
- voltage battery (without consumers) < 12.3 V – indicating discharged battery.
Without consumers :
- adjusted voltage > 14.8 V – indicating defective regulator;
- adjusted voltage < 13.2 or charging current < 2A – indicating charging failure.
With consumers:
- adjusted voltage > 14.8 – indicating defective regulator.
- adjusted voltage < 12.7 – indicating that alternator charging current must be checked
compared with its characteristics:
If the measured current is too small, check the following:
- alternator wear (collector brushes, etc);
- battery connections;
- engine mass stripe;
- drive belt tension.
If the measured current is correct and the adjusted voltage is too small, the cause may be: -the vehicle has too many electric consumers;
- the battery is discharged.
